Graduation Rate at Hobart and William Smith Colleges

The graduation rate at Hobart and William Smith Colleges is 73.67%. 428 students have completed their degree out of 581 degree seeking candidates last year. The retention rate is 87% at Hobart and William Smith Colleges.
  • Graduation Rate: 73%
  • Retention Rate: 87%
  • Earning after 10 years of graduation: $62,700

Number of Completers and Graduation Rate by Gender

The graduation rate at Hobart and William Smith Colleges is 73%. The rate is based on number of completers within 150% normal time (For example, 6 years for 4-year bachelor's degree program). Total 428 students have completed their degree out of 581 candidates who seeking Bachelor degree. Graduation Rate for Bachelor's Degree by Completion Time

The next table shows the graduation rate by completion time for bachelor's at Hobart and William Smith Colleges. The graduation rate in 100% normal time (in 4 years or less) is 67.64%, the 125% normal time (in 5 years) rate is 72.81%, and 150% normal time (in 6 years) rate is 73.67%

Average Earning After Graduation from Hobart and William Smith Colleges

The next table summarizes the average earning by years after graduation from Hobart and William Smith Colleges. After 6 years of graduation, the mean earning is $46,500 and, after 10 years of graduation, the mean earning is $62,700 for Hobart and William Smith Colleges graduates.
